Oil consumption by region in Russian Federation
Russian Federation: Oil consumption by region was 1,994 terawatt-hours in 2025. ▼ Falling
Oil consumption by region in Russian Federation, 1985–2025
Source: Energy Institute - Statistical Review of World Energy (2026) – with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in terawatt-hours.
Analysis
Russian Federation recorded 1,994 terawatt-hours for oil consumption by region in 2025.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.1% on the previous year and up 10.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, oil consumption by region in Russian Federation peaked at 3,027 terawatt-hours in 1989 and was at its lowest, 1,456 terawatt-hours, in 2002.
That places Russian Federation 5th out of 80 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the top 10%.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 41 years of available data.
Oil consumption by region in Russian Federation, year by year
| Year | terawatt-hours |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1985 | 2,936 terawatt-hours | — |
| 1986 | 2,971 terawatt-hours | +1.2% |
| 1987 | 2,996 terawatt-hours | +0.8% |
| 1988 | 2,972 terawatt-hours | -0.8% |
| 1989 | 3,027 terawatt-hours | +1.9% |
| 1990 | 2,985 terawatt-hours | -1.4% |
| 1991 | 2,908 terawatt-hours | -2.6% |
| 1992 | 2,777 terawatt-hours | -4.5% |
| 1993 | 2,316 terawatt-hours | -16.6% |
| 1994 | 2,046 terawatt-hours | -11.7% |
| 1995 | 1,785 terawatt-hours | -12.7% |
| 1996 | 1,540 terawatt-hours | -13.8% |
| 1997 | 1,527 terawatt-hours | -0.8% |
| 1998 | 1,463 terawatt-hours | -4.2% |
| 1999 | 1,495 terawatt-hours | +2.2% |
| 2000 | 1,466 terawatt-hours | -2.0% |
| 2001 | 1,509 terawatt-hours | +3.0% |
| 2002 | 1,456 terawatt-hours | -3.5% |
| 2003 | 1,509 terawatt-hours | +3.6% |
| 2004 | 1,488 terawatt-hours | -1.4% |
| 2005 | 1,494 terawatt-hours | +0.4% |
| 2006 | 1,570 terawatt-hours | +5.1% |
| 2007 | 1,562 terawatt-hours | -0.5% |
| 2008 | 1,612 terawatt-hours | +3.2% |
| 2009 | 1,546 terawatt-hours | -4.1% |
| 2010 | 1,605 terawatt-hours | +3.8% |
| 2011 | 1,722 terawatt-hours | +7.3% |
| 2012 | 1,781 terawatt-hours | +3.4% |
| 2013 | 1,785 terawatt-hours | +0.2% |
| 2014 | 1,876 terawatt-hours | +5.1% |
| 2015 | 1,812 terawatt-hours | -3.4% |
| 2016 | 1,839 terawatt-hours | +1.5% |
| 2017 | 1,833 terawatt-hours | -0.3% |
| 2018 | 1,851 terawatt-hours | +1.0% |
| 2019 | 1,889 terawatt-hours | +2.0% |
| 2020 | 1,816 terawatt-hours | -3.9% |
| 2021 | 1,931 terawatt-hours | +6.3% |
| 2022 | 1,982 terawatt-hours | +2.7% |
| 2023 | 2,005 terawatt-hours | +1.2% |
| 2024 | 1,996 terawatt-hours | -0.5% |
| 2025 | 1,994 terawatt-hours | -0.1% |
